Hong Kong
1st of July 1997 Hongkong was transferred to China. For more than 100 years it was leased to Britain and it has enjoyed the status of business city and tax heaven. Even today Hongkong retains its cosmopolitan identity. There are news of protests today against the China Extradition Bill. We also remember the umbrella movement for democracy. Hongkong is a small island rather group of islands south of China flourished as busy port and trading city.
